  1. Eugene Lipinski (born 5 November 1956) is a British-Canadian character actor and screenwriter. He was born in Wansford Camp, [dubious – discuss] Soke of Peterborough, England, and raised in Regina, Saskatchewan, Canada. He began acting at the age of twelve in amateur theatre.

  5. Eugene Lipinski, (5 November 1956), is a British-Canadian character actor. He was born in England but raised in Saskatchewan, Canada. He began acting when he turned twelve, beginning in amateur theatre. He returned to the UK from Canada after he had graduated from the University of Regina.
